The System Test Engineer will lead the Verification and Validation (V&V) activities for Intellian’s L-Band Centre of Excellence team based in London, ensuring new products entering our L-band global product portfolio meet all applicable requirements and regulatory standards.
Responsibilities:
- Lead the verification and validation lifecycle for products developed by the L-Band Centre of Excellence.
- Lead the integration testing of new products under development.
- Write and execute test plans, procedures and reports to ensure products meet various requirements that include regulatory compliance, satellite operator type approvals, and product specifications.
- Work closely with the development team to refine test strategies, diagnose problems and improve product quality.
- Provide input Design For Test and other V&V requirements during the product definition and development phases.
- Work closely with Engineering, QA and Production teams in the Korean HQ.
- Manage and coordinate the compliance and specialty test activities executed by third-party test labs.
- Maintain a high standard of documentation and reporting.
- Complete Root Cause Analysis investigations into issues observed during development and failures observed in the field.
- Provide training and technical support as required to other members.
Experience - Mandatory:
- Experience in integration & block testing of incremental software & hardware releases for products and/or projects.
- Authoring test documentation (plans, procedures, reports).
- Excellent debugging, failure analysis and problem-solving abilities.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- Understanding of EMI/EMC and their measurement methods.
- Experience with regulatory compliance testing (eg ETSI, FCC, EU Directives etc).
- Proficiency with Python scripting for test equipment control, test automation and data analysis.
- Prior experience with satellite or wireless communication terminals.
- Experience with RF and electronics test equipment (including Spectrum Analysers, VNAs, Power Meters, Oscilloscopes etc).
- Experience with work management and bug reporting tools (eg Jira).
- Type approvals and homologation experience.
- Experience running field and/or customer trials.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's or Master’s degree in RF/electronic/electrical engineering or similar discipline, or equivalent professional experience.
